New smooth muscle research findings from F. Gandia and co-authors described

Published in Respiratory Therapeutics Week, August 9th, 2010

A report, 'Inhaled magnesium fluoride reverse bronchospasma,' is newly published data in Journal of Smooth Muscle Research = Nihon Heikatsukin Gakkai Kikanshi. According to a study from France, "Asthma is a global health problem. Asthma attacks are becoming more severe and more resistant to usual treatment by beta(2) agonists nebulisation."

"The search for a new product that could reduce the morbidity of asthmatic disease seems necessary. The objective of this study was to compare the effectiveness of inhaled magnesium fluoride (MgF(2)) with that of magnesium sulphate (MgSO(4)) 15% alone and sodium fluoride (NaF) 0.5 M alone in rats pre-contracted by methacholine...
